SURVEY OF COSMETICS FOR SEVEN INORGANIC ELEMENTS 129 cobalt, lead, and nickel were determined by ICP-MS. Mercury was determined by cold vapor atomic fl uorescence spectrometry (CVAFS) because it offers higher sensitivity and reduced interferences relative to ICP-MS for mercury determinations. The analyses were conducted by Frontier Global Sciences (Frontier, Bothell, WA), a private laboratory under contract with FDA. T able V.
